Clement Taylor Park is a peaceful retreat nestled in Destin, Florida, perfect for families and nature lovers. With its lush greenery, playgrounds, and calm water views, this park offers a relaxing escape from the bustling beach scene. Visitors can enjoy picnicking, walking along scenic paths, or simply unwinding in the serene atmosphere while taking in the natural beauty of the area.

Getting There

  • Car

    If you are driving, head towards Calhoun Ave from your current location in Destin Beach. Use a navigation app if needed. Once you reach Calhoun Ave, turn onto it. Clement Taylor Park is located at 131 Calhoun Ave, Destin, FL 32541. The park is situated near the intersection of Calhoun Ave and Gulf Shore Dr. There is free parking available at the park.

  • Public Transportation

    If you prefer public transportation, check local bus schedules for routes that go to Calhoun Ave. The nearest bus stop will be along the main routes within Destin Beach. Depending on the service, you may need to walk a short distance from the bus stop to reach Clement Taylor Park, which is located at 131 Calhoun Ave. Ensure to have exact change for the bus fare, which typically ranges around $1-2.

  • Walking

    If you are staying nearby, walking to Clement Taylor Park can be a pleasant option. Locate Calhoun Ave and follow the signs towards the beach area. The park is directly accessible and well-marked, located at 131 Calhoun Ave. Remember to stay hydrated and wear comfortable shoes.

  • Biking

    If you have access to a bike, riding to Clement Taylor Park is another enjoyable option. Utilize the bike lanes available on the major roads within Destin Beach, and make your way to Calhoun Ave. The park is located at 131 Calhoun Ave, where you will find bike racks for parking your bike securely.

Discover more about Clement Taylor Park

Clement Taylor Park is a hidden gem located in the charming city of Destin, Florida. This picturesque park is a fantastic destination for visitors seeking a break from the crowded beaches and the hustle of tourist attractions. The park features a wide array of amenities, including well-maintained walking paths, inviting picnic areas, and a playground that is perfect for families with children. Surrounded by lush greenery and offering stunning views of calm waters, the park provides a peaceful sanctuary for relaxation and leisure.One of the park's highlights is its tranquil atmosphere, making it an ideal spot for nature lovers and those looking to enjoy a leisurely stroll or a quiet afternoon. The park is open year-round from morning until evening, allowing visitors ample time to explore its beauty at their own pace. Whether you're interested in birdwatching, taking photographs, or simply soaking in the serene environment, Clement Taylor Park has something for everyone.In addition to its natural charm, the park is conveniently located within proximity to various dining options and other attractions in Destin. This allows visitors to easily combine their park visit with a day of exploring the local culture and cuisine.
